Southeast CC defeats The Lady Red Devils despite Baileigh Rager's strong effort, 4-0

Baileigh Rager did her best to change the outcome, but Rager couldn't will The Lady Red Devils past Southeast CC as The Lady Red Devils lost 4-0 in seven innings in Iola, KS on Sunday.

Rager was a workhorse on the rubber for The Lady Red Devils. Rager allowed no earned runs, six hits and no walks while striking out four over seven innings of work.

Megan Hartman recorded the win for Southeast CC. She tossed seven innings of shutout ball. Hartman struck out 12, walked one and gave up three hits.

Rager was the game's losing pitcher.

Southeast CC never trailed after scoring two runs in the third on an error and a groundout by Alexis Graewe.

Southeast CC matched its one-run fourth inning with one more in the seventh. In the fourth, Southeast CC scored on a passed ball, bringing home Shannon Smith.
